//! Cranelift DSL classes.
//!
//! This module defines the classes that are used to define Cranelift
//! instructions and other entities.
pub mod formats;
pub mod instructions;
pub mod isa;
pub mod operands;
pub mod settings;
pub mod types;
pub mod typevar;
/// A macro that converts boolean settings into predicates to look more natural.
#[macro_export]
macro_rules! predicate {
($a:ident && $($b:tt)*) => {
PredicateNode::And(Box::new($a.into()), Box::new(predicate!($($b)*)))
};
(!$a:ident && $($b:tt)*) => {
PredicateNode::And(
Box::new(PredicateNode::Not(Box::new($a.into()))),
Box::new(predicate!($($b)*))
)
};
(!$a:ident) => {
PredicateNode::Not(Box::new($a.into()))
};
($a:ident) => {
$a.into()
};
}
/// A macro that joins boolean settings into a list (e.g. `preset!(feature_a && feature_b)`).
#[macro_export]
macro_rules! preset {
() => {
vec![]
};
($($x:ident)&&*) => {
{
let mut v = Vec::new();
$(
v.push($x.into());
)*
v
}
};
}
/// Convert the string `s` to CamelCase.
pub fn camel_case(s: &str) -> String {
let mut output_chars = String::with_capacity(s.len());
let mut capitalize = true;
for curr_char in s.chars() {
if curr_char == '_' {
capitalize = true;
} else {
if capitalize {
output_chars.extend(curr_char.to_uppercase());
} else {
output_chars.push(curr_char);
}
capitalize = false;
}
}
output_chars
}
#[cfg(test)]
mod tests {
use super::camel_case;
#[test]
fn camel_case_works() {
assert_eq!(camel_case("x"), "X");
assert_eq!(camel_case("camel_case"), "CamelCase");
}
}
